It is important to note that the GTA Online servers for PlayStation 3 were officially shut down on December 16, 2021.

If you are looking for the 1.27 update pkg file today, you are likely looking to mod the game for offline play or for use on a modified console (CFW/ODE). On a stock, unmodded PS3, the game is now strictly an offline, single-player experience. The "Online" features are permanently disabled by Rockstar's server termination.

Before we get into the technical details of the PKG file, let’s examine the update itself. Version 1.27 was not the final update for the PS3 (that honor goes to 1.29), but it was one of the most substantial.

Money glitches and rank recovery tools (like Target Mode or Apocalypse Tool) were perfected on 1.27. Later updates patched many of these specific memory hacks.
